作者:god | 来源:互联网 | 2023-09-11 10:47
导读:很多朋友问到关于php数组形式怎么取值的相关问题,本文编程笔记就来为大家做个详细解答,供大家参考,希望对大家有所帮助!一起来看看吧!
本文目录一览:
1、php数组值的获取
2、php,如何取出数组中的值,
3、PHP 怎么从数组中取值
4、php如何取出数组中的一个值
php数组值的获取
/* 数组变量名为$test */
$id = -1;
foreach ($test as $t) {
if ($t['name'] == 2) {
$id = $t['id'];
break;
}
}
if ($id != -1) {
echo "the id is: " . $id . "\n";
} else {
echo "can not find the item in array.\n";
}
如上代码所示,遍历一遍数组即可。
php,如何取出数组中的值,
楼主的写法不太对:
定义数组: $arr=array(0=12,1=23455);
定义关联数组时用的是 = 符号,符号左边的键值不加 [ ]
要把数组赋值给一个变量才能访问,如:$arr
这时通过键值就可以访问数组中的值了,$arr[0] 就是 12 ,$arr[1] 就是 23455
不指定数组的键值,默认就是0,1,2,3,4,5,……从零开始递增的整数
PHP 怎么从数组中取值
//你可以用下面的方式试下,我这边考虑到的是遍历哈,假设上面的数组名字为$cate_arr
foreach($cate_arr as $v){
$values = array_values($v);
if(in_array("分类1", $values)) {
$id = $v["id"]; //这样就可以得到分类1的ID值了
break;
}
}
php如何取出数组中的一个值
php中取出数组键值的写法是 array_name[key]
key是数组的下标或数组对象的键名
例:$arr=array("a","b","c");
echo $arr[1]; //打印 b
$arr=array("a"="这是A","b"="这是B","c"="这是C");
echo $arr["b"]; //打印 这是B
结语:以上就是编程笔记为大家整理的关于php数组形式怎么取值的相关内容解答汇总了,希望对您有所帮助!如果解决了您的问题欢迎分享给更多关注此问题的朋友喔~